Laser Cutting Machine Power and Performance

Laser Cutting Machine power defines cutting depth and speed. Metal thickness decides required wattage. Low power limits job scope. High power boosts output and growth.

Speed and Accuracy Matter

Fast machines raise daily output. Accurate beams reduce rework. Stable frames prevent vibration issues.

Laser Cutting Machine Size and Workspace Needs

Laser Cutting Machine bed size must match sheet dimensions. Large sheets need wider beds. Small shops need compact layouts.

Machine Footprint and Shop Space

Measure your floor area first. Leave space for loading sheets. Plan room for maintenance access.

Automation and Loading Systems

Auto loaders save labor time. Manual loading suits low volume shops.

Laser Cutting Machine Cost and Long Term Value

Laser Cutting Machine price should match output goals. Cheap machines raise repair costs later. Smart buyers check total ownership cost.

Running and Maintenance Costs

Power use affects monthly bills. Good cooling lowers wear. Quality parts cut repair needs.

Return on Investment Planning

Higher speed means more orders. Less waste means more profit. Growth planning protects your budget.
